Tapper, Leona Leela Siff was born on January 27, 1918 in Akron, Ohio, United States. Daughter of David M. and Dorothea (Rossen) Siff.

Bachelor, University Michigan, 1938. Postgraduate, University Wisconsin, 1938—1940. Art student, Cleveland Institute Art, 1944—1948.
Art student, Art Students League, New York City, 1949—1951. Art student, Han Hoffman, Provincetown, Massachusetts, 1951—1953. Master of Arts New York University, 1965.
Private art teacher, New York City, 1952—1958. Art teacher j.r. high school, 1958. Private art teacher, 1959—1962, Jaffa, Israel, 1962—1993, Baltimore, 1993—1999.
Private art therapist, New York City, 1955—1958.
Member mental health executive committee Riverdale, New York City, since 1961. Member executive committee Hospital Joint Diseases, 1956—1958. UPA representative New Lincoln School, 1954—1962, High School Music and Art, New York City, 1954—1962.
Member Denver Civic Symphony, 1942—1945, Florida String Quartet, 1949—1951. Member of Artists Equity Association New York.
Married William Tapper, August 1942 (deceased ). Children: Bruce Elliot, Devore Tapper Treewater. Married Paul Revivi, August 1984 (deceased ).
